Surface treatments of fiber posts

Abstract:

The material and design of root canal post has already been well investigated. The fiber posts and resin core are thought to have a satisfied prosthetic effect. Nowadays, the research focuses on the adhesion and retention of fiber posts. Besides the research on cement, surface treatment is widely studied to enhance the interfacial bond strength. It can promote the formation of chemical and mechanical adhesion between different ingredients when surface treatment is performed. Surface treatment of fiber posts can enhance the retention of fiber posts and the adhesion between fiber posts and resin cores. The purpose of this article was to review different surface treatments of fiber posts.

Key words: root canal fiber posts, surface treatment, bond strength
